An automated vending machine dispenses freshly baked cupcakes from the popular bakery chain, Sprinkles. These machines offer a convenient and novel way to purchase the brand’s signature treats outside of traditional store hours. Typically stocked with a variety of flavors, these automated kiosks allow customers to select and purchase individual cupcakes or curated boxes using a touchscreen interface and electronic payment.

This innovative approach to pastry retail provides increased accessibility for consumers, extending brand reach beyond geographical and temporal limitations of brick-and-mortar locations. By offering 24/7 availability, these machines cater to late-night cravings and impulse purchases, enhancing customer satisfaction and potentially driving higher sales volumes. The concept emerged from a desire to provide constant access to fresh, high-quality cupcakes, mirroring the convenience of automated teller machines for cash withdrawals.

2. Freshly Baked Cupcakes

The emphasis on “freshly baked cupcakes” is central to the Sprinkles cupcake ATM model. Maintaining product freshness within an automated dispensing system presents a unique challenge, requiring careful consideration of baking schedules, inventory control, and storage conditions within the machine itself. The promise of fresh product directly influences consumer perception and purchasing decisions, linking product quality with the brand’s overall value proposition. For example, a consumer choosing a cupcake from an ATM at 10 PM expects comparable freshness to a product purchased during regular bakery hours. This expectation necessitates a robust supply chain and rigorous quality control measures throughout the distribution process.

Several factors contribute to preserving cupcake freshness within the ATM. Temperature control is crucial, requiring a regulated environment within the machine to prevent spoilage. Furthermore, the automated system must manage inventory effectively to minimize the time each cupcake spends in the machine before purchase. Regular restocking with freshly baked goods is essential, ideally aligned with peak demand periods. The ability to offer consistently fresh product distinguishes the Sprinkles cupcake ATM from traditional vending machines often associated with pre-packaged, shelf-stable items. This commitment to freshness strengthens brand reputation and reinforces the premium nature of the product.
